WebNov 10, 2024 · Use a protective case when your glasses aren’t on your face. Don’t pull your glasses off roughly by one arm—instead, take them off gently by gripping both sides of the frame. Avoid placing your glasses in your pocket or bag by themselves. Don’t wear glasses on the top of your head where you might forget about them. WebYour first stop for any broken item is usually the manufacturer, and sunglasses are no different. Oakley may be able to repair your sunglasses, depending on the extent of damage and your warranty. Generally, Oakley sunglasses come with a two-year warranty from the date of your purchase.

Clean your glasses well with lens cleaner and a soft cloth. Mix 1 to 2 teaspoons of baking soda in water to form a thick paste. Apply the paste over the scratched area of the glass using soft cotton. WebDec 12, 2024 · What you can do is: Rinse the lens using a mild dish soap, or spray the lens with a doctor-approved lens spray, then let it air-dry. Wipe the lens with a microfiber cloth specifically designed for glasses. WebWARRANTY ORDER REDO. A one-time change in lens color, glasses style, or prescription specification is available within 60 days of the original shipping date at no charge. For prompt processing of a redo, please call Oakley Standard Issue at 1-800-525-4334.
